The Texas Association of School Boards (TASB) Board of Directors recently announced that it has elected Tony Raymond to an interim position on the board to represent TASB Region 7.

Raymond was appointed President of the Sabine ISD Board of Trustees in 2016. He has served the board since 2004 and helped establish the Sabine Education Foundation in 2016 which has raised over $350,000 for deserving teachers and students.

Raymond has been a member of Rotary International since 2012 and is actively involved in the Rotary Youth Leadership Awards, a program to help young people develop leadership skills. He is also a scout leader for Boy Scout Troop 259, serving as scout leader since 2005.

He is currently employed at UniFirst Corp and has more than 25 years of experience in sales.

Since its inception in 1949, the TASB serves and represents local school boards to speak with a unified voice to decision makers to determine the best future for Texas public schools and students.
